Output 300901b7119e192f80d8c4db34ae7fd5e687b4cf3eb025f0cbb8d1b07486d978:0

value
978760
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1a12c19bfbb2cfd7d5c023224f032d39591435a9 OP_EQUAL
address
344sxjvsS5FSnAjGwhgXWLVBQ53jeE3hKw
transaction
300901b7119e192f80d8c4db34ae7fd5e687b4cf3eb025f0cbb8d1b07486d978
confirmations
127665
spent
true